Casca Paints, a manufacturer of paints and emulsions, owns a user-friendly Web site. The Web site allows customers to upload pictures of their house and select the colors that best match their expectations
Donnel Designs Inc., an interior decoration firm, enters into a partnership with Casca Paints. As a result, customers can now get a complete interior design solution for their homes. This is an example of a(n)__________.
Fill in the blanks with correct word.
ANSWER: strategic alliance
Casca Paints and Donnel Designs Inc. have formed a strategic alliance. A strategic alliance is defined as a cooperative agreement between business firms. Strategic alliances or strategic partnerships can take the form of licensing or distribution agreements, joint ventures, research and development consortia, and partnerships.
